Etched has unveiled an ambitious AI inference machine initiative, providing startups with access to cutting-edge technology. This move is significant as it enables startups to develop and deploy AI models more efficiently, driving innovation in the industry.
The Etched AI inference machine initiative utilizes a combination of hardware and software advancements, including specialized chips and optimized algorithms, to accelerate AI model inference. This allows startups to focus on developing their AI applications without worrying about the underlying infrastructure.
The AI inference machine market is becoming increasingly competitive, with major players like Google, Amazon, and Microsoft investing heavily in their own initiatives. According to recent market research, the global AI inference market is expected to grow to $12.2 billion by 2025, with the Asia-Pacific region driving much of this growth.
